Under Armour’s speedskating suits were blamed for the American team’s dismal showing at the 2014 Sochi games. A post-Olympic review by the U.S. team vindicated the technology. But the suits have been redesigned, and the company is hoping for redemption in 2018.
Here & Now‘s Robin Young speaks with Under Armour’s Chief Innovation Officer Clay Dean (@deancrew7).
